On 25/04/19 6:57 PM, Faiz Abbas wrote:
> Fix the following minor things:
>
> 1. Line wrapping with the regmap_*() functions is way more conservative
> than required by the 80 character rule. Expand the function calls out to
> use less number of lines.
>
> 2. Add an error message if the DLL fails to lock.

Please make the white space changes a separate patch.

Also I would prefer not to use "fix" in the subject unless the patch fixes
driver behaviour.
